Multimode image navigation system for ultrasonic guidance operation

The invention discloses a multimode image navigation system for an ultrasonic guidance operation. An ultrasonic image system acquires preoperative image data and stores the preoperative image data to a preoperative data module, and the ultrasonic image system extracts the preoperative image data to construct human three-dimensional model data and stores the human three-dimensional model data to a preoperative data module. A locating module acquires position information of an ultrasonic probe in an operative instrument and the ultrasonic image system and transmits the position information to the ultrasonic image system. The ultrasonic image system extracts the human three-dimensional model data stored in the preoperative data module and matches the position information with the human three-dimensional model data. A display module acquires and displays the information matched by the ultrasonic image system. Images are presented in real time in an operation by locating an operative area through real-time ultrasonic data according to the preoperative image data and the human three-dimensional model data, the operative instrument is accurately located according to the locating module, and the position of the operative instrument in a human model is presented.

Automatic tracking system for operative region of laparothoracoscope and method

The invention discloses an automatic tracking system for an operative region of a laparothoracoscope. The automatic tracking system comprises a controller, an operative instrument, an image collecting module, an image caching module, an operative region identifying module and an image display module, wherein the controller is used for monitoring a minimally invasive surgery process in enterocoelia and thoracic cavity; the operative instrument is arranged in an instrument channel of the laparothoracoscope, is connected with the controller and is used for performing the minimally invasive surgery in the enterocoelia and thoracic cavity; the image collecting module is arranged in a shooting channel of the laparothoracoscope, is connected with the controller and is used for shooting the images of the organs and the minimally invasive surgery process in the enterocoelia and thoracic cavity; the image caching module is connected with the controller and is used for storing the images in the enterocoelia and thoracic cavity; the operative region identifying module is connected with the controller and the image caching module and is used for identifying the image of the operative instrument in the shot images; the image display module comprises a whole image display module and an operative region image display module and is used for displaying the image of the minimally invasive surgery process. The automatic tracking system for the operative region of the laparothoracoscope can automatically track the local image of the operative region in real time while realizing the panorama image display and also can freely amplify the local image.

Intelligent electronic endoscope system passing through natural orifices

The invention belongs to the field of medical appliances, and particularly relates to an intelligent electronic endoscope system passing through natural orifices. The intelligent electronic endoscope system is suitable for a colposcope system, an anorectal endoscope system and a hysteroscope system, and comprises an electronic endoscope, an endoscope clamping mechanical arm for fixing the electronic endoscope, a movable adjustment operating platform, an intelligent robot-arm, a control desk and a central processing system, wherein the tail end of the main body of the endoscope is provided with a linear type robot-arm passage running through a hard working end part. By using the intelligent electronic endoscope system, a patient needs no operation, only the electronic endoscope is put inside through the natural orifices, and the intelligent robot-arm is put into an operation area by taking the intelligent robot-arm passage of the electronic endoscope as a platform; and the intelligent robot-arm is miniaturized, deformable and direction-changeable and simultaneously is provided with functions of a plurality of operative instruments (such as operative snap-on tongs, electric cutting equipment, electric coagulation equipment and the like), and thus, various operation treatments can be performed without introducing other instruments, and the difficulty of operations and the paint of patients are reduced.

The invention discloses a left abomasal displacement operative reduction apparatus for cattle. The left abomasal displacement operative reduction apparatus is applied to the field of animal medicine and is an operative instrument for treating left abomasal displacement for the cattle. The operative reduction apparatus comprises a reduction needle transmitting device and reduction needles with line binding holes. The reduction needle transmitting device comprises three transmitting tubes and a sensing positioning device. The left abomasal displacement operative reduction apparatus has the advantages that abomasal fixing lines can be accurately, efficiently and stably conveyed to target positions on the right sides of abomasal walls of the ill cattle without opening the right sides of the abomasal walls of the cattle; the probability of injury to the cattle due to reduction needle conveying errors can be eliminated; the conveying distances of the reduction needles can be increased owing to a retractable handle, so that the abomasa of the cattle with different body sizes can be assuredly reduced to perfect positions; potential risks caused after the reduction needles penetrate the abomasal wall of the cattle and fly out can be prevented; only one operative person is required for performing left abomasal displacement on the cattle by the aid of the operative reduction apparatus and can independently complete operation without assistants.
